North County Society of Fine Arts Membership Exhibit
On exhibit April 2-April 27, 2025
Members of the North County Society of Fine Arts demonstrate a variety of art techniques and media, including oil, watercolor, acrylic, pastel and mixed media. Every artist embarks on an “art journey”; this exhibit shows viewers the art journeys of several of it's members. The subject matter and techniques are as varied as the artists themselves.
NCSFA is a non-profit organization that has played a role in the community since 1996. The organization's mission is to promote the education and appreciation of the arts with art demonstrations, workshops, exhibits and other related art functions. Another important purpose of this group is the awarding of an annual scholarship to one or more local high school seniors who are pursuing an art career.
